Diagnosis
. Recognizable by having pronotal basal angles sharp at apex, usually not denticulate (occasionally very small denticle present); elytra punctate and pubescent (glabrous in specimens from
Japan
) only on lateral intervals, with microsculpture on elytral disc in baso-medial portion consisting of more or less isodiametric meshes and usually with one to four preapical setigerous pores in interval 7; metepisterna less than 1.3 times as long as wide; protibia usually with two ventroapical spines in transverse row; and apical spur of protibia not dentate at margins. The internal sac of the median lobe of aedeagus (
Figs 32–33
) is with a large longitudinal spiny patch along the left side. Body length
9.4–14.6 mm
.
Distribution
.
China
: the north-eastern, eastern and south-eastern parts. It was recorded from Heilongjiang, Liaoning, Nei Mongol, Shaanxi, Hebei, Shandong, Shanxi, Henan, Jiangsu, Shanghai, Zhejiang, Gansu, Sichuan, Hubei, Hunan, Guizhou, Fujian, Guangxi, and Guangdong (
Kataev
et al
. 2003
;
Liang & Liu 2007
). As
H. niigatanus
,
Hua (2002)
reported probably this species also from Jilin and Anhui.
Harpalus pastor
is recorded here from Beijing and Xizang for the first time. Additional material from Shaanxi, Henan and Hunan is also provided.
The species is also known from the southern Russian Far East (Amur Province, Khabarovsk and Maritime Territories, southern Kurils), North and
South Korea
including Jejudo, and
Japan
(Hokkaido, Honshu, Shikoku, Kyushu, and Ryukyu Islands) (
Habu 1973
;
Lafer 1989
;
Kryzhanovskij
et al
. 1995
;
Kataev 1997
;
Kataev
et al
. 2003
; Moon &
Paik 2006
).

Remarks
. The geographical variation of
H. pastor
and status of the taxa described by
Schauberger (1929
,
1930
) were discussed by
Kataev (1997
,
2002
). The species is variable geographically, but only
H. p.
niigatanus
Schauberger occurring in
Japan
, discriminated by glabrous lateral intervals of the elytra and shorter metepisterna, warrants the rank of a subspecies.
Examination of the
type
specimens of
H. penglainus
and
H. chiloschizontus
, described from Shandong and Fujian provinces respectively, revealed that both these taxa are conspecific with the nominative subspecies of
H. pastor
.
